                              You need to be sure you didn't rupture your pectoralis major tendon. Usually you will get bruising on your upper arm and may see a deformity of the pec muscle wher it ties into the shoulder area. This is a surgical problem (as I can personally attest to) and if you wait too long it can not be repaired. You need to see an orthopedist or sports medicine doctor asap.
